Spiritual awareness quotes:

  • I think that growth and spiritual awareness come in slow increments. Sometimes you don't know it's happening. -- Mariel Hemingway
  • Ultimately spiritual awareness unfolds when you're flexible, when you're spontaneous, when you're detached, when you're easy on yourself and easy on others. -- Deepak Chopra
  • Ecology and spirituality are fundamentally connected, because deep ecological awareness, ultimately, is spiritual awareness. -- Fritjof Capra
  • The real alchemy is transforming the base self into gold or into spiritual awareness. That's really what new alchemy's all about. -- Fred Alan Wolf
  • It is just a wonderful, wonderful time to be alive and to be able to be part of the ever-growing spiritual awareness that is happening around the world. -- Jon Anderson
  • We must intend to live [the new spiritual awareness], to integrate each increased degree of awareness into our daily routine. It only takes one negative interpretation to stop everything. -- James Redfield
  • At the deepest level of ecological awareness you are talking about spiritual awareness. Spiritual awareness is an understanding of being imbedded in a larger whole, a cosmic whole, of belonging to the universe. -- Fritjof Capra
  • Those whose spiritual awareness has been awakened never make a false move. They don't have to avoid evil. They are so replete with love that whatever they do is a good action. They are fully conscious that they are not the doer of their actions, but only servants of God. -- Ramakrishna
  • To the vast majority of people a photograph is an image of something within their direct experience: a more-or-less factual reality. It is difficult for them to realize that the photograph can be the source of experience, as well as the reflection of spiritual awareness of the world and of self. -- Ansel Adams
  • The noblest pleasure is the joy of understanding. -- Leonardo da Vinci
  • Only that day dawns to which we are awake. -- Henry David Thoreau
  • It is not the answer that enlightens, but the question. -- Eugene Ionesco
  • The most common form of despair is not being who you are. -- Soren Kierkegaard
  • Reality is that which, when you stop believing in it, doesn't go away. -- Philip K. Dick
  • If the doors of perception were cleansed everything would appear to man as it is, infinite. -- William Blake
  • The ultimate lesson all of us have to learn is unconditional love, which includes not only others but ourselves as well. -- Elisabeth Kubler-Ross
  • The moment one gives close attention to any thing, even a blade of grass it becomes a mysterious, awesome, indescribably magnificent world in itself. -- Henry Miller
  • It is love alone that leads to right action. What brings order in the world is to love and let love do what it will. -- Jiddu Krishnamurti
  • All major religious traditions carry basically the same message, that is love, compassion and forgiveness the important thing is they should be part of our daily lives. -- Dalai Lama
  • If you concentrate on finding whatever is good in every situation, you will discover that your life will suddenly be filled with gratitude, a feeling that nurtures the soul -- Harold S. Kushner
  • The eye through which I see God is the same eye through which God sees me; my eye and God's eye are one eye, one seeing, one knowing, one love. -- Meister Eckhart
  • Man has no Body distinct from his Soul; for that called Body is a portion of Soul discerned by the five Senses, the chief inlets of Soul in this age. -- William Blake
  • Man is lost and is wandering in a jungle where real values have no meaning. Real values can have meaning to man only when he steps on to the spiritual path, a path where negative emotions have no use. -- Sai Baba
  • Evil (ignorance) is like a shadow-- it has no real substance of its own, it is simply a lack of light. You cannot cause a shadow to disappear by trying to fight it, stamp on it, by railing against it, or any other form of emotional or physical resistance. In order to cause a shadow to disappear, you must shine light on it -- Shakti Gawain
  • Many of us who have experienced psychedelics feel very much that they are sacred tools. They open spiritual awareness. -- Stanislav Grof
  • I am attracted to intelligence, a witty sense of humor, an adventurous outlook on life and spiritual awareness about one's self and the world. -- Tanit Phoenix
  • Our physical world seems ready and able to accommodate the needs of the spiritually awakened new Superhuman. The constraints or demands of our material world are not the real problem; it is our own spiritual awareness and philosophical wisdom that is lagging behind. -- Anthon St. Maarten
  • Humanity may destroy the possibilities for life on earth unless the freedom and power that we have acquired are channeled in new creative directions by a spiritual awareness and moral commitment that transcend nationalism, racism, sexism, religious sectarianism, anthropocentrism, and the dualism between human culture and nature. This is the great issue for the 1990s and the twenty-first century. -- Steven Clark Rockefeller
  • Only a spiritual being has awareness. -- Chick Corea
  • When we are truly aware of our spiritual glory, a varicose vein or two is not that big a deal. -- Marianne Williamson
  • Raising awareness, changing the marketplace, effecting spiritual change - whatever it is that you decide is your thing, go for it. -- Stone Gossard
  • I have an awareness of a spiritual realm, and I see signs that I feel speak to me - I don't know if that falls into superstition. -- Ken Leung
  • The great awareness comes slowly, piece by piece. The path of spiritual growth is a path of lifelong learning. The experience of spiritual power is basically a joyful one. -- M. Scott Peck
  • A lot of people in spiritual life use the awareness of difference, and the spiritual glorification of difference, as a justification to indulge in that which is ultimately unreal. -- Andrew Cohen
  • I've been able to dig deeper into awareness of my own sinfulness, and take baby steps toward spiritual healing. I'm able to worship in an ancient communion full of awesome beauty, one that is now being blessed with quiet revival. -- Frederica Mathewes-Green
  • Enlightened leadership is spiritual if we understand spirituality not as some kind of religious dogma or ideology but as the domain of awareness where we experience values like truth, goodness, beauty, love and compassion, and also intuition, creativity, insight and focused attention. -- Deepak Chopra
  • It makes a difference what we choose to experience during sleep. Many of us think of sleep as a chance to get away from it all. But sleep is also a chance to return to the joys of our spiritual heritage - our universal awareness. -- Henry Reed
  • In my own life I know that my state of cheerfulness is a reliable gauge of my level of spiritual enlightenment at that moment. The more cheerful, happy, contented, and satisfied I am feeling, the more aware I am of my deep connection to Spirit. -- Wayne Dyer
  • This is going to sound pretentious and esoteric, but I truly mean it from the bottom of my heart. Acting has always been a spiritual journey for me. The very first project I ever acted on paralleled my experience so perfectly even before I was aware of it. -- Kandyse McClure
  • The requirements for our evolution have changed. Survival is no longer sufficient. Our evolution now requires us to develop spiritually - to become emotionally aware and make responsible choices. It requires us to align ourselves with the values of the soul - harmony, cooperation, sharing, and reverence for life. -- Gary Zukav
  • One of the most beautiful ways for spiritual formation to take place is to let your insecurity lead you closer to the Lord. Natural hypersensitivity can become an asset; it makes you aware of your need to be with people and it allows you to be more willing to look at their needs. -- Henri Nouwen
  • There is no such thing as spiritual achievement; it is simply an awareness intrinsic to all of life. -- Frederick Lindemann, 1st Viscount Cherwell
  • You are living in a time when opportunities for self-empowerment, expanded awareness and spiritual growth appear to be unlimited. -- Barbara Marciniak
  • One of the goals of a spiritual practice is self-awareness, and one of the best tools of self-awareness is simple emotional vulnerability. -- Moby
  • Spiritual awareness is not only one of the keys to the healing process. Spiritual awareness is the only way that healing can occur. -- Deepak Chopra
  • The proof of spiritual maturity is not how pure you are but awareness of your impurity. That very awareness opens the door to grace. -- Philip Yancey
  • The role of biblical counselors is facilitate the discovery of a greater God awareness through spiritual eyes that look at life through scriptural lenses. -- James MacDonald
  • No matter what your spiritual condition is, no matter where you find yourself in the universe, your choice is always the same: to expand your awareness or contract it. -- Thaddeus Golas
  • Yoga teaches us both to let go and to have exquisite awareness in every moment. We remember our essential spiritual nature and life becomes more joyful, meaningful, and carefree. -- Deepak Chopra
